Activities

Activity type Activity value Assay description Source Reference
Behavior (functional) 0 General behavior in mice after oral administratin of the compound (500 mg/kg) using acute toxicity assay; Convulsions ChEMBL. 8386248
ED50 (functional) = 10.6 mg kg-1 Analgesic activity in mice using p-phenylquinone test. ChEMBL. 8386248

Inhibition (functional) = 23 % Anti-inflammatory effect expressed as % inhibition at 50 mg/kg in acute carrageenan paw edema test in rats ChEMBL. 8386248
Mortality (ADMET) = 90 % Percent mortality in mice after oral administratin of the compound (500 mg/kg) using acute toxicity assay ChEMBL. 8386248
